Przyjrzyjmy się działaniu vsync

Vsync (vertical refresh sync) to technologia synchronizacji między kartą graficzną a monitorem, która ma na celu zlikwidowanie problemu zwanego „złamaniem ramki”.

Kiedy karta graficzna generuje klatki szybciej niż monitor je wyświetla, może dojść do złamania ramki, które objawia się jako widoczne pionowe pęknięcie na ekranie. Vsync eliminuje ten problem, dopasowując prędkość odświeżania karty graficznej do prędkości odświeżania monitora.

Podczas działania vsync, karta graficzna czeka na sygnał od monitora o gotowości do wyświetlenia nowej klatki. W momencie, gdy monitor jest gotowy, karta graficzna wyśle gotową ramkę, co zapobiega złamaniu ramki i zapewnia płynne wyświetlanie obrazu.

Jednak vsync może wpływać na wydajność gier i innych aplikacji wymagających natychmiastowej odpowiedzi od karty graficznej. Dlatego niektóre gry dają możliwość wyłączenia vsync w celu zwiększenia liczby klatek na sekundę (FPS), ale kosztem ewentualnych wizualnych artefaktów, takich jak screentearing.

Wniosek: Vsync jest ważnym narzędziem, które zapewnia płynne wyświetlanie obrazu, eliminując złamanie ramki. Jednak jego wyłączenie może zwiększyć wydajność w niektórych aplikacjach kosztem jakości wizualnej. Wybór należy do użytkownika.

Działanie vsync

Vsync (synchronizacja pionowa) jest technologią używaną w komputerach i konsolach do monitorowania i regulowania liczby klatek wyświetlanych na sekundę. Działanie vsync polega na synchronizacji wyświetlanych klatek z częstotliwością odświeżania monitora.

Kiedy vsync jest włączony, karta graficzna komputera wysyła sygnał do monitora, który informuje go o gotowości wyświetlenia nowej klatki obrazu. Monitor odczekuje do momentu, w którym jest gotowy, a następnie wyświetla klatkę. Po wyświetleniu klatki, monitor czeka na kolejny sygnał przed wyświetleniem następnej klatki. Ten proces jest powtarzany, utrzymując stałą synchronizację między kartą graficzną a monitorem.

Działanie vsync ma kilka zalet. Po pierwsze, zapobiega efektowi tearingu, który występuje, gdy klatki obrazu nie są zsynchronizowane, prowadząc do nieestetycznego rozdarcia obrazu. Po drugie, vsync zmniejsza zużycie mocy karty graficznej, ponieważ nie musi ona generować klatek, które nie są wyświetlane na monitorze. Oznacza to również zmniejszenie generowanego ciepła i hałasu przez kartę graficzną.

Zalety działania vsync:

  • Zapobieganie efektowi tearingu.
  • Mniejsze zużycie mocy karty graficznej.
  • Mniejsze generowanie ciepła i hałasu przez kartę graficzną.

Wady działania vsync:

  • Zwiększenie opóźnień wyświetlania obrazu (input lag).
  • Możliwość wystąpienia stutteringu – nierówności w płynności animacji.

W zależności od preferencji użytkownika i wymagań gry, vsync może zostać włączony lub wyłączony. Głównie jest stosowany do gier o wysokiej intensywności graficznej, gdzie wymagana jest płynna i estetyczna animacja. Wyłączenie vsync może prowadzić do zwiększenia liczby generowanych klatek (FPS), ale może pojawić się efekt tearingu.

Zalety vsync

Vsync (synchronizacja pionowa) to technika wykorzystywana w grach i programach komputerowych, która ma na celu zrównoważenie częstotliwości odświeżania monitora z ilością generowanych klatek przez procesor. Dzięki temu zapewnia płynniejsze i bardziej stabilne wyświetlanie obrazu.

Zapobieganie efektowi tearingu

Główną zaletą vsync jest eliminacja efektu tearingu – rozdarcia obrazu na ekranie. Efekt ten występuje, gdy obraz wyświetlany na monitorze nie jest zsynchronizowany z częstotliwością odświeżania. Tearing prowadzi do przekłamań w wyglądzie obrazu i może powodować negatywne doznania wzrokowe użytkownika. Dzięki vsync obraz jest renderowany w całości przed wyświetleniem, co eliminuje problem rozdarcia i daje odbiorcy płynne doświadczenie wizualne.

Zapobieganie efektowi stutteringu

Kolejnym plusem vsync jest zapobieganie efektowi stutteringu – niepłynnego wyświetlania obrazu. Stuttering występuje, gdy ilość generowanych klatek przez procesor nie jest zsynchronizowana z częstotliwością odświeżania monitora. W rezultacie niepłynnie działająca gra może przynieść użytkownikowi frustrację i utrudnić interakcję z grą. Zastosowanie vsync minimalizuje ilość generowanych klatek, by dopasować je do częstotliwości odświeżania, co pozwala na płynne wyświetlanie obrazu i lepsze wrażenia z gry.

Aby korzystać z zalet vsync, warto pamiętać, że wymaga ona odpowiedniego sprzętu, kompatybilności z wykorzystywanym oprogramowaniem oraz ustawienia prawidłowej harmonizacji częstotliwości klatek z częstotliwością odświeżania monitora.

Wady vsync

Chociaż vsync ma wiele korzyści, ma również kilka wad, które warto wziąć pod uwagę.

1. Opóźnienie inputu

Włączenie vsync powoduje opóźnienie między ruchem myszy a pojawieniem się odpowiedzi na ekranie. Dla graczy, którzy wymagają szybkich reakcji, może to być frustrujące.

2. Zwiększone obciążenie procesora i karty graficznej

Włączenie vsync zwiększa obciążenie zarówno procesora, jak i karty graficznej, ponieważ muszą one synchronizować pracę między sobą. Może to prowadzić do obniżonej wydajności i płynności działania gry.

3. Możliwość pojawienia się stutteringu

Podczas korzystania z vsync istnieje możliwość wystąpienia stutteringu, czyli krótkotrwałego przycięcia obrazu. Może to zdarzyć się, gdy liczba klatek na sekundę spadnie poniżej oczekiwanego poziomu.

Mimo tych wad, vsync nadal jest używane przez wielu graczy i użytkowników komputerów. Ostatecznie, zrozumienie jego korzyści i wad pozwoli podjąć świadomą decyzję co do jego włączenia lub wyłączenia w zależności od indywidualnych preferencji i potrzeb.


Amelia Dąbrowski

Redaktor

Rate author
Najlepszy poradnik ogrodniczy